Music, Muscle, and Memory: A Dementia Fitness Breakthrough | Ep. 524
Falls are one of the biggest fears in memory care — but new research suggests the fix might be simpler than we think. Host Aaron Fish sits down with Deborah Rothschild, founder of ToughAgers LLC and creator of Debra Does Fitness, live from the Eden Alternative International Conference. Deborah unpacks a 9-week study comparing resistance training, aerobic exercise, and social visits in people with dementia — and reveals which approach actually improved cognition. She also explains the four types of memory that shape how you should coach a fitness session, why she borrows principles from her former career as a Montessori preschool teacher, and how music tied to someone's "sticky years" can unlock movement other cues can't reach.
